How does Cuyahoga Falls, OH compare to Newark, OH? Cuyahoga Falls has a population of 50,864 with a median household income of $70,645, while Newark has 50,393 residents and a median income of $58,920.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Cuyahoga Falls, OH | Newark, OH |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 50,864 | 50,393 | +0.9% |
| Median Age | 38 | 38.8 | -2.1% |
| Foreign Born % | 7.4% | 2% | +270.0% |
| Metric | Cuyahoga Falls | Newark |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$70,645 | $58,920 | +19.9% |
| Unemployment | 4% | 3.5% | +14.3% |
| Poverty Rate | 9.8% | 17.5% | -44.0% |
| Bachelor's+ | 37.5% | 22.1% | +69.7% |
| Metric | Cuyahoga Falls | Newark |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$174,700 | $174,100 | +0.3% |
| Median Rent | $1029/mo | $926/mo | +11.1% |
| Housing Units | 24,678 | 22,236 | +11.0% |
